The part you refer to (Coil Resistive Cord) is the king lead.
Whether or not that's what your friend means is another matter
Ask him if he means the lead that goes from the ignition coil to the dizzy cap.
If you've replaced all the other ignition components but not this then it's certainly worth doing do.
